About RenderMan Studio |
RenderMan Studio marks a significant step forward in the evolution of Pixar's tools for cg artists and studios. By integrating powerful, extensible components like Slim, Alfred, and it with the seamless workflow provided by the RenderMan for Maya plug-in, as well as support for procedural DSOs and RIB-out functionality, RenderMan Studio is a best of both worlds package, with quick-and-easy access to cutting edge features for artists' desktops and industrial-strength capabilities for complex pipelines and renderfarms.
RenderMan Studio's implementation of the Render Man for Maya plug-in, RenderMan for Maya Pro, is a fully-integrated, plug-in version of Pixar's RenderMan renderer. It also serves as a bridge between Maya and RenderMan Pro Server, through its RIB-out functionality. The plug-in provides seamless access to RenderMan's speed, power, and stability for Maya users while imposing minimal changes to the Maya workflow.
RenderMan for Maya Pro takes all of your Maya scene data Maya Materials, lights, geometry, particles, et cetera and renders them with Pixar's RenderMan, right out of the box. Simply select RenderMan as your renderer and render directly to the Render View (or 'it') window with RenderMan.
Slim is a powerful, extensible tool for creating, manipulating, using, and reusing RenderMan shaders, bringing the power of RenderMan shaders into the hands of artists. Users can construct RenderMan shaders by interactively combining modules into networks, editing their parameters, and previewing the results, all without writing any code.
Alfred is a work distribution system that manages a hierarchy of parallel client applications connected to remote servers. The Alfred components are general purpose but they are especially well-suited for managing network-distributed rendering in the context of the RenderMan Studio.
it is a robust framebuffer/render view window, offering complete floating point support and a powerful and flexible catalog, as well as a fast and powerful imaging tool that is capable of production-qualilty image manipulation and compositing usually found only in high-end standalone products.
